What is WSO2 Identity Server?
WSO2 Identity Server provides
security and identity management of enterprise web applications, services, and
APIs. The most recent version of Identity Server acts as an Enterprise Identity
Bus (EIB) — a central backbone to connect and manage multiple identities
regardless of the standards on which they are based.
WSO2 Identity Server Features
- Supported: System and User Identity Management
- Supported: User and Groups Provisioning
- Supported: User and Groups Management
- Supported: Entitlements Management
- Supported: XACML 2.0/3.0 Support
- Supported: Lightweight, Developer Friendly and Easy to Deploy
- Supported: Manage and Monitor

WSO2 Identity Management for Cloud Health services
We use WSO2 IDM to support access and authentication to all our online cloud services. We have 30k plus users who authenticate via the service to access various systems such as a clinical trial management services and learning management system.
It is mainly in use on Amazon Web Services.

- It's open source so is highly configurable
- WSO2 provides their own paid support which is an essential add-on
- Implementation is straightforward and conforms to all major standards
- Overall, the product works well but does take time and effort to implement in highly complex environments. However, I do not believe this is unique to WS02.
- WSO2 works well when you need specific user sign-up information and allows you to then tailor the access, for example, to the job role or area of discipline. We use this to tailor the learning offered to a user upon initial login.
